Experience and Training
I attended the Orange County School of the Arts, studying in both the Guitar and Popular Music conservatories. There, I competed as a classical guitarist, studied music theory, gained experience playing in bands, and developed a passion for the bass guitar. In college I continued my studies with modern virtuoso Felix Pastorius, deepening my understanding of jazz and music theory, while going on to play and record music all over California.
My Teaching Philosophy
The most important parts of learning music are playing with others and simply enjoying it. My approach with each lesson is to identify music that inspires my students, and flip between the roles of instructor and jam partner as we learn it. Additionally, as a student of Physical Therapy I understand and actively implement foundational principles of motor learning and control to help my students efficiently overcome technical challenges on their instrument.
